    Quote Originally Posted by MadSativa
    clear pots are a no no, you need pots that allow no light in their,, light trims roots or kills roots how ever you want to say it.
    the clear cups are inside a dark cup, no light touches the roots, you can pick up the clear cup to check root growth for transplant, my first time at this method, I like it so far- both cups are heavily punched for drainage and the clear is split to easily remove for the transplant:thumbsup:
